OKRA IN GARLIC OYSTER SAUCE SALAD | CHINA FOOD CHINESE ...



Okra in Garlic Oyster Sauce Salad | China Food Chinese ... image

Okra in Garlic Oyster Sauce Salad | China Food Chinese Cold Dish

Provided by Easyfoodcook.com

Categories     Appetizer    Salad

Total Time 5 minutes

Prep Time 2 minutes

Cook Time 3 minutes

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 7

300 grams okra
1 garlic
1 tablespoon cooking oil
2 tablespoons light soy sauce
1 tablespoon oyster sauce
1 teaspoon sugar
2 tablespoons flour

Steps:

  • The first step is to pour the flour into the water and stir it evenly, pour the okra to wash off the fluff on the surface.
  • Once the water's boiling, add a little salt and a few drops of oil, then pour okra and cook for 2 minutes.
  • Remove the okra and let it cool, then cut it in the middle and place it on a plate.
  • Take a small bowl, pour in soy sauce, oyster sauce, sugar, add a little water and stir to make a sauce.
  • Mince the garlic. Add oil to the pan, pour the minced garlic and stir-fry until golden.
  • Pour the sauce and bring to a boil, the water will evaporate slightly.
  • Pour the minced garlic sauce over the okra while it's hot.

CHINESE OKRA | RECIPES WIKI | FANDOM
About Chinese okra. A long, cylindrical variety of squash, native to Asia, that is generally harvested when it is between 1 to 2 feet in length, but can be grown as long as 8 to 10 feet. It has a dark green outer skin with longitudinal ridges covering a somewhat spongy and fiberous pulp, somewhat similar to a cucumber.

SERIOUSLY ASIAN: LUFFA
May 15, 2019 · This vegetable goes by many names: luffa, angled luffa, Chinese okra, and silk squash. Dark green with ridges that run every quarter inch or so through the length of the squash, Chinese okra does not have much in common with the little finger-length squash we know as okra in the States.

HOW TO COOK CHINESE OKRA? – KITCHEN
Mar 08, 2021 · Chinese okra can be eaten raw when young and around 15 centimeters long and 3 centimeters thick. More mature fruits can be prepared much like zucchini. They are peeled and sliced or cut into bite-sized pieces for stir-fry, battering and deep frying, to add to fish soups, dahls, or curries.
